Description

Carboxyterbinafine is a key pharmaceutical intermediate and chemical building block. This compound is valued for its role in the synthesis of advanced antifungal agents and other active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s). It is primarily utilized by research institutions, pharmaceutical manufacturers, and fine chemical producers engaged in the development and production of therapeutic compounds. Our supply ensures high purity and batch-to-batch consistency for critical applications.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: A crucial precursor in the synthesis of Terbinafine and related antifungal APIs.
  • Research & Development: Used in medicinal chemistry for the discovery and optimization of new therapeutic agents targeting fungal infections.
  • Fine Chemical Synthesis: Serves as a specialized building block for constructing complex organic molecules in custom synthesis projects.
  • Reference Standard: Employed as an analytical standard in quality control laboratories for method development and validation.
  • Biochemical Research: Utilized in studies investigating the mechanism of action of squalene epoxidase inhibitors.

Basic Information

Product Name Carboxyterbinafine
CAS No. 99473-14-0
Molecular Formula C21H25NO2
Molecular Weight 323.43 g/mol
Synonyms (2E)-N,6,6-Trimethyl-N-(naphthalen-1-ylmethyl)hept-2-en-4-yn-1-amine-1-carboxylic acid; Carboxy Terbinafine; Terbinafine Carboxylic Acid; (E)-1-Carboxy-N,6,6-trimethyl-N-(1-naphthylmethyl)-2-hepten-4-yn-1-amine; 99473-14-0; 1-Carboxyterbinafine
